Program Overview


Program Overview

The Chinese University of Hong Kong offers a comprehensive program in Chinese Medicine, specifically the "中醫女性保健證書課程" (Chinese Medicine Women's Health Certificate Course). This program is designed to provide students with a systematic understanding of traditional Chinese medicine and its application in women's health.

Program Structure

The program consists of five modules, covering:


  1. Basic Theories of Traditional Chinese Medicine: Introduction to the fundamental principles of traditional Chinese medicine, including yin-yang theory, five elements theory, qi, blood, body fluids, zang-fu organs, and meridian theory.
  2. Chinese Medicine for Skin Care: Application of traditional Chinese medicine in skin care, including dietary therapy and external methods for skin health.
  3. Women's Physiological Cycle Health Care: Health care for women during different physiological cycles, including dietary therapy and medication.
  4. Traditional Chinese Medicine for Pregnancy and Childbirth: Introduction to traditional Chinese medicine for pregnancy and childbirth, including pre-pregnancy preparation, dietary therapy during pregnancy, and postpartum care.
  5. Occupational Health for Women: Health care for working women, including stress management, dietary therapy, and exercise.

Program Objectives

Upon completion of the program, students will be able to:


  • Describe the basic theories of traditional Chinese medicine
  • Explain the physiological characteristics and health care of women at different ages and during different physiological cycles
  • List common Chinese medicines and their applications
  • Describe basic health preservation methods
